1919 Monday, 28 Cementing in front if barn door in morning. Brock chopping in afternoon. Da hoeing in gardens.mHoeing mangels after tea. Over to Harshels with some beans. Fine but windy. XTuesdayX 29 Men hoeing mangels and scuffling. Brock & I to celebration Old boys re union in Palmerston afternoon and evening. Fine but very windy. Wednesday, 30 Men hoeing and scuffling turnips. Mr. Henderson called in evening. Fine and warm.
